| TAIR | AT3G14270.1 | phosphatidylinositol-4-phosphate 5-kinase family protein. Encodes a protein that is predicted to act as a 1-phosphatidylinositol-3-phosphate (PtdIns3P) 5-kinase based on its homology to Fab1 from yeast. It contains an FYVE domain required for binding to PtdIns3P-containing membranes in yeast, as well as a Cpn60_TCP1 homology domain plus a kinase domain. fab1a/fab1b pollen grains not viable and have defective vacuolar organization. | 0 |
